Hong Kong actor Eric Tsang said he will be taking legal action against the person who started the rumour. Photo: Filepic
Talks of Tsang, 70, investing in a scam group went rampant on social media after multiple reports on Sept 1 claimed that the Hong Kong actor was arrested by authorities as part of an investigation into the matter.on Sunday , Tsang firmly denied the rumours and said that he only became aware of the accusations after multiple friends informed him of the news on social media.
During the interview, Tsang expressed dissatisfaction over how much fake news is being spread daily and urged everyone to stop creating rumours as it may bring dire consequences to innocent people. "Fake news has harmed so many people and not just in the entertainment scene. It's easy to write a few words and photos, but it can affect someone's entire life.
